The linseed trade from Northern Europe to Brittany
| During the 18 th century, the textile industry of Brittany needs linseed from the Baltic countries. The Lübeck's merchants monopolise this trade and organise the trafic to be the most profitable. In the French harbours, the factors of the merchants from Lübeck do the same.The peasants are obliged to follow the rules and pay a lot of money to get the products they need.
